Early 20th Century German Art, Part 2 - the Graphic Art of Sascha Schneider


This rather intense looking man was Sascha Schneider (1870-1927), a gay German graphic artist who flouted both artistic and social conventions of his time.  Born in St. Petersburg, Russia, he was educated at the Dresden Academy of Fine Arts.  He bravely contributed articles to the first known homosexual publication, Der Eigene, a fact often overlooked by modern gay art historians.  Schneider's work is often homoerotic, and he founded a body building institute at one point that he used as a source for models.  So our Friday night art lesson is all about Sascha.
